当前位置: 首页 > news >正文

做零食的网站seo推广软件排行榜

做零食的网站,seo推广软件排行榜,邯郸市人口,服装公司网站定位阿里云使用Docker部署MySQL服务,并且通过IDEA进行连接 这里演示如何使用阿里云来进行MySQL的部署,系统使用的是Linux系统 (Ubuntu)。 为什么使用Docker? 首先是因为它的可移植性可以在任何有Docker环境的系统上运行应用,避免了在不通操作系…

阿里云使用Docker部署MySQL服务,并且通过IDEA进行连接

这里演示如何使用阿里云来进行MySQL的部署,系统使用的是Linux系统 (Ubuntu)。

为什么使用Docker? 首先是因为它的可移植性可以在任何有Docker环境的系统上运行应用,避免了在不通操作系统上产生的各种适配问题。另外还有其他的比如,环境隔离,易于部署和维护等等优势。

阿里云

  1. 首先拥有一个阿里云的服务器,然后根据下面指令去安装Docker:

    • 这一步是常规建议操作更新下先,防止任何的不适配
    sudo apt-get update
    sudo apt-get upgrade
    
    • 安装Docker
     sudo apt install docker
    
  2. 安装好之后需要先进行阿里云的镜像配置加速,因为docker是外网需要科学上网,直接拉取镜像可能拉取不到。这里镜像加速的配置的网址:阿里云配置镜像加速器

    或者直接输入以下命令:

    sudo mkdir -p /etc/docker
    sudo tee /etc/docker/daemon.json <<-'EOF'
    {"registry-mirrors": ["https://uylbxudk.mirror.aliyuncs.com"]
    }
    EOF
    sudo systemctl daemon-reload
    sudo systemctl restart docker
    

这里的配置结束后就可以正常的拉取所需要的镜像了。

部署MySQL

  1. 启动Docker
sudo systemctl start docker 
sudo systemctl enable docker
  1. 创建一个Docker网络,以便不同容器之间通信
sudo docker network create mysql-network

为什么要创建单独的Docker网络?

  • 便于容器之间的通信:如果你有多个容器需要相互通信,比如一个应用容器和一个数据库容器,放在同一个网络中可以让它们通过容器名称相互访问,而不是依赖IP地址。

  • 增强隔离和安全性:自定义网络让你的容器彼此隔离,只有在同一个网络中的容器才能互相访问,这样增加了安全性,防止其他容器或主机访问它们。

  1. 启动MySQL容器
sudo docker run --name mysql-container --network mysql-network -e MYSQL_ROOT_PASSWORD=yourpassword -d -p 3306:3306 mysql:latest

​ 使用换行符便于理解:

sudo docker run --name mysql-container \--network mysql-network \-e MYSQL_ROOT_PASSWORD=yourpassword \-d \-p 3306:3306 \mysql:latest
  • sudo docker run:使用sudo权限运行Docker容器。

  • --name mysql-container:为容器指定一个名称mysql-container

  • --network mysql-network:将容器连接到名为mysql-network的Docker网络。

  • -e MYSQL_ROOT_PASSWORD=yourpassword:设置mysql的用户密码,默认root用户。

  • -d:以分离模式运行容器(后台运行)。

  • -p 3306:3306:将主机的3306端口映射到容器的3306端口。

  • mysql:latest:使用最新版本的MySQL镜像。(如没有会自动拉取)

以上的操作都完成后使用 docker ps 命令查看mysql服务是否在运行:
在这里插入图片描述

  1. 配置阿里云安全组放行3306端口,这一步很重要不然外部不能连接。
  • 找到服务器的安全组:

在这里插入图片描述

  • 放行3306端口,可以选择 ‘‘快速添加’’ 直接勾选MySQL,或者手动添加都可以:
    在这里插入图片描述

测试连接MySQL

通过本地终端直接测试MySQL连接(本地需要有mysql):

mysql -h [yourIPAddress] -P 3306 -u root -p

通过IDEA工具来测试连接:

  1. 配置

在这里插入图片描述

  1. 测试连接成功

在这里插入图片描述

http://www.dinnco.com/news/20927.html

相关文章:

  • 网站建设与管理期末小米口碑营销案例
  • 不会建网站如何找做网站的公司
  • 市场监督管理局局长锦州网站seo
  • html网站的直播怎么做杭州seo招聘
  • 在一家传媒公司做网站编辑_如何?电商平台有哪些
  • seo 网站案例搜索引擎营销的案例
  • 网站建设登录长沙有实力seo优化
  • 婚纱摄影网站html怎么在百度上添加自己的店铺地址
  • 专业网站建设组织百度seo排名技术必不可少
  • 做网站加盟app推广在哪里可以接单
  • 为什么做网站备案的人态度差怎么免费制作网页
  • 管理咨询师宁波网站推广优化哪家正规
  • 网站设置会员网站怎样优化seo
  • 网站多大需要服务器网络技术推广服务
  • 网站设计 macseo学途论坛网
  • 日本人做的摇滚网站有什么好的推广平台
  • 成都网站搜索排名优化哪家好企业网站建设方案策划书
  • 深圳网站建设费用大概多少百度指数指的是什么
  • 做网站需要什么技术员宁波网站制作优化服务
  • 关于集团网站建设的修改请示百度网站
  • 武汉seo人才济南网站优化排名推广
  • 大连金州代做网站公众号南昌关键词优化软件
  • 网站创建方案sem与seo的区别
  • 餐饮公司网站建设策划书云南新闻最新消息今天
  • iis2008如何做网站优化培训学校
  • 织梦cms电影网站源码关键词优化怎么优化
  • 杭州市萧山区哪家做网站的公司好东莞新闻头条新闻
  • 网站开发未按合同约定工期完工博客是哪个软件
  • 做门户网站长沙社区赚钱吗杭州seo外包
  • 青岛制作网站的域名注册平台